Colts Prepare to Confront Jacksonville in Crucial AFC South Duel
The Indianapolis Colts are set to face off against the Jacksonville Jaguars in a pivotal AFC South matchup, with the Jaguars currently occupying the top spot in the division. For the Colts, this game represents more than just a chance to improve their standing; it’s an opportunity to finally shake off a long-standing hex. The team has not secured a victory in Jacksonville since 2014, a streak that has become a talking point among fans and analysts alike.

Injury Report Insights
In terms of personnel, the Colts had just one player sidelined during Thursday’s practice, reflecting a relatively healthy roster as they head into this critical encounter. Here’s a rundown of the team’s injury report:
CB Sauce Gardner (Calf) – Did Not Participate (DNP)
DE Tyquan Lewis (Ankle) – Limited Participation (LP)
QB Daniel Jones (Fibula) – Full Participation
LB Jaylon Carlies (Ankle) – Full Participation
WR Josh Downs (Hip, Knee) – Full Participation
CB Kenny Moore II (Illness, Ankle) – Full Participation
